Game Overview
In Thrifty Business, players begin with a small store and limited resources. The main objective is to grow the business by managing products, serving customers, and improving the store’s overall performance.
Players must decide which products to sell, manage prices, and ensure that customers remain satisfied. Efficient management and smart financial planning are key to expanding the business.
